Holywood, which has won many Best Kept Town awards over the years, is just 15 minutes drive from Belfast city centre, with excellent public transport links. It is an attractive, fashionable town on the shores of Belfast Lough, with many historic Victorian buildings, specialist shops, high quality hotels, guesthouses, restaurants and art galleries. In the 19th century, a large number of Belfast’s merchants and traders built imposing country and coastal retreats in Holywood and the town proudly retains its rich heritage, becoming a designated Conservation Area two years ago.

A number of production companies, post-production facilities, PR companies and advertising agencies are based in and around Holywood, making it a media hub second only to Belfast.

ACCESS BY AIR:

Belfast City Airport is located 5 minutes drive from Holywood and is the destination for a range of domestic flights, served by British Airways, British European, British Midland, Aer Arann (Cork) and Flykeen. Belfast International Airport is approximately 35 minutes away by road and is served by a number of international scheduled airlines: EasyJet, bmibaby, Jet2.Com, Eastern Airways. Dublin Airport is just over 2 hours drive away and is served by 28 international scheduled airlines with worldwide connections. A regular bus service operates between Belfast International Airport and Belfast city centre. A regular coach service operates daily between Belfast and Dublin Airport.

ACCESS BY RAIL:

Regular train services operate between Belfast Central Station and Holywood (10 minutes). The high speed Enterprise train operates a regular daily service between Belfast Central Station and Dublin Connolly Station (2 hours)

ACCESS BY ROAD:

Holywood is situated along the A2 dual carriageway between Belfast and Bangor (15 minutes from Belfast city centre). With ongoing upgraded road links between Belfast and Dublin, the driving time between Dublin Airport and Belfast city centre currently stands at approximately 2 hours. A regular bus service operates between Belfast city centre and Holywood.
